Why To Use jQuery Over JavaScript!!

In this article we are going to talk about the major and important differences between jQuery and JavaScript which makes the prior one more advance than the latter. Both JavaScript and jQuery are client-side scripting libraries that are used for tasks like verification, creating visually appealing elements such as fancy navigation menus, etc. Because both the technologies (jQuery and JavaScript) have the same purpose, the decision of utilizing a specific technology lies with the programmers. In recent years, jQuery is quickly gaining popularity on JavaScript (JavaScript has been around for some a greater number of years than JQuery). Let's discuss the possible benefits of jQuery on javaScript.

ü jQuery is well compiled and efficient:-
jQuery has a strong community that works well in verifying and listing modules on the official portal. Let's consider for instance that a programmer wishes to utilize 'Date Picker' (the Date Picker component is utilized to choose a date from the pop up calendar. When chosen, the date value in the adjacent text box will be populated. This spares the composing time for end clients). If the programmer has picked JQuery, he will download the module quickly from the official website. On the other hand, if the same programmer has picked JavaScript, then he will search for the open source JavaScript code on Google for the 'Date Picker' element. There will be tens or hundreds of outcomes from which one must be picked up. Most probably, the code he would utilize would not have been confirmed or verified. So it becomes clear that jQuery is definitely well-organized and well-compiled. Reliable solution is possible with jQuery which may or may not be possible with JavaScript for most of the time.


ü Less testing effort is required:-
Before being made accessible for programmers, jQuery components are tested on every single popular browsers such as Mozilla Firefox, Internet Explorer, Google Chrome etc. Therefore the programmer does not need to test a component on all browsers. Thus, programmer enjoy the freedom of testing it on any one of the browsers. However, with JavaScript, there is no guarantee that the components will look and carry on a similar route in all browsers. That's why programmers using JavaScript need to do broad testing on all the browsers. Trial can be a daunting task when the number of JavaScript components used is high.

ü Less debugging effort is required:-
jQuery libraries are modular and very readable. They are more compact than Javascript. Being modular and compact, the jQuery code debugging makes it completely easier than JavaScript.   

ü jQuery is constantly updated:-
jQuery libraries are continually updated. Whenever web technologies and browsers evolve and become more advance, there are always compatibility issues with JavaScript libraries. But with JQuery it is not so. jQuery libraries are constantly updated to suit new changes in web technologies that interact with client side scripts.


Conclusion:-
So, at last all the reasons mentioned above makes the jQuery more advance and compatible for the programmer to use it in their codes rather than simply using JavaScipt. Using jQuery will also make your code more smoother and understandable because of having lots of predefined functions comparing to javaScript.

Kotlin as a New Trend!!

Since, Java is ruling over the market of Android App Development from its invention time. But as the time and trend changes, a new programming language is immerging in this field, this is “Kotlin”. The ranking of Kotlin is getting so higher with the time that it may become one of the top 20 programming languages!
So, in this article we are going to know a brief introduction about Kotlin and how it is getting so popular. So, let’s start.

v Introduction
It is an open source programming language and is based on JVM (Java Virtual Machine). Kotlin is the brainchild of JetBrain programmer based in Russia. This new language is now a part of the latest Android studio version 3.0.
For more than 20 years, the Java market is ruling on and obviously, it has the quality of the impeccable features and capabilities provided. Otherwise, it would not be possible for it to rule over the market from  long time. However, this may sound strange but you cannot ignore the "aging" aspect of Java. Kotlin comes in the picture. A new, modern, advanced Android dedicated language offering a remarkable set of profits. If you choose Kotlin, read the list of benefits and go to those you can avail.

Ø Interoperability
Can you think of the situation, where in the same project, you can use two different programming languages? Well, with kotlin, this is possible. When using Kotlin, you do not need to switch to a different project or need to change existing code. You can easily access its features and make the app development process easier.

Ø Low coding
Let's think of a simple thing! When you can write only a few lines of code, why would you write hundred lines of code? Yes, to write a special task in Java, you can do this by writing about 20% less code in Kotlin. Well, no wonder why Android developers are going crazy all over it!
Undoubtedly, this 'low coding' feature not only reduces the boilerplate coding amount, but also improves code execution.

Ø Easy learning curve
One of the most interesting facts about Kotlin is this it has a easy learning curve. Unlike the Android version, you can easily master it by going to the list of language references. It has a thin and intuitive syntax that is decent for Java experts. If you already have skills in Java, learning Kotlin is nothing for you!

Ø Safe and secure
Working with Kotlin is a little safer option for developers. Wondering why? Well, with its help, you can prevent important errors like NullPointExceptions. Its compiler automatically blocks the mistakes. Occasionally, a developer may ignore a small mistake, but thanks to the Kotlin compiler, who will not allow this to happen.

Ø Zero adoption cost
The word 'free' or 'zero cost' easily pulls the attention of people! Kotlin will not disappoint users in this case too. How? Well, this is an open source language. Therefore, you will not have to spend a single penny to get it. Just get the converter tool that can convert all existing Java files into Kotlin and that's it! You are ready to start with this impressive high-end language.


Conclusion:-
However, Kotlin is rapidly gaining popularity in the market, but for beginners of the Android app development area, it is always advisable to start learning process with Java. Because yet Java is the most popular and used programming language in the App Development field. And you should learn it first.
